TAG, THEY'RE IT: SHAZAM'S BIG JUMPERS

Jack U's Diplo-produced "Where Are U Now" featuring Justin Bieber, powered by big Pop radio adds, is the biggest gainer on this week's Shazam USA Top 100 tags chart. Other jumpers include Kendrick Lamar, whose "King Kunta" got a splashy Times Square video unveiling last week; Rachel Platten, whose "Fight Song" is looking like a monster; and Tinashe, whose "All Hands on Deck" jumps 36 spots. On the U.K. side, Jack U is joined in the Biggest Gainers circle by, among others, Kodaline and Tove Lo.
